Key Components of Mobile Hydraulic Systems

Understanding the key components of mobile hydraulic systems is essential for effective maintenance and service:

  • Hydraulic Pumps: These are vital for converting mechanical energy into hydraulic energy, facilitating fluid movement within the system.
  • Hydraulic Fluids: These fluids transfer power throughout the system, maintaining the necessary lubrication and cooling effects.
  • Hydraulic Cylinders: These components convert hydraulic energy back into mechanical energy, offering movement to equipment.
  • Valves: Serves to control the flow and direction of hydraulic fluids, crucial for operating machinery effectively.
  • Filters: Essential for ensuring the hydraulic fluid remains clean, filters prevent contaminants from damaging system components.

Best Practices for Maintaining Mobile Hydraulic Systems

Routine Maintenance Tips for Longevity

Proper maintenance is crucial for extending the lifespan of mobile hydraulic systems:

  • Regular Inspections: Schedule consistent inspections to identify potential issues before they escalate.
  • Fluid Checks: Monitor hydraulic fluid levels and quality, replacing fluids as needed to ensure system efficiency.
  • Filter Replacements: Replace filters regularly to maintain fluid cleanliness, preventing damage to hydraulic components.
  • Leak Checks: Routinely inspect systems for leaks, addressing any deterioration immediately.
  • Components Lubrication: Keep key components lubricated to enhance performance and reduce wear and tear.

Common Signs of Hydraulic System Failure

Identifying signs of failure early can save time and expense:

  • Poor Performance: Sudden changes in machine operation, like sluggish movements, indicate potential issues.
  • Unusual Noises: Grinding or abnormal noises can signal mechanical issues needing immediate attention.
  • Fluid Leaks: Puddles or stains beneath equipment are red flags suggesting system failure risk.
  • Erratic Movements: Unpredictable machine functions point to hydraulic malfunctions that require professional assessment.
  • Overheating: Excessive heat generation during operation can suggest that components are not functioning efficiently.
